Effect of Sunshine Strength



Occasionally, the intensity of sunshine can considerably affect the performance of solar panels. When the sunshine is solid and straight, your photovoltaic panels produce even more electrical energy. However, during over cast days or when the sunlight is at a low angle, the panels get much less sunlight, reducing their performance. To maximize the power output of your photovoltaic panels, it's vital to mount them in areas with enough sunshine exposure throughout the day. Think about elements like shading from nearby trees or buildings that might obstruct sunshine and reduce the panels' performance.

To enhance the efficiency of your photovoltaic panels, regularly tidy them to get rid of any type of dust, dust, or particles that might be blocking sunshine absorption. In addition, guarantee that your panels are tilted appropriately to get the most direct sunshine feasible.

Impact of Temperature Level Modifications



When temperature level changes take place, they can have a substantial impact on the performance of solar panels. Photovoltaic panel work ideal in cooler temperature levels, making them more effective on moderate days contrasted to very warm ones. As the temperature boosts, solar panels can experience a decline in efficiency because of a sensation known as the temperature coefficient. This effect triggers a decrease in voltage result, inevitably impacting the total power manufacturing of the panels.

Function of Cloud Cover and Rain



Cloud cover and rains can dramatically affect the efficiency of photovoltaic panels. When clouds block the sunlight, the quantity of sunlight reaching your solar panels is lowered, resulting in a reduction in power production. Rainfall can also affect solar panel efficiency by obstructing sunshine and producing a layer of dust or gunk on the panels, additionally lowering their capacity to produce electrical energy. Also light rainfall can spread sunlight, creating it to be much less focused on the panels.



Throughout cloudy days with heavy cloud cover, photovoltaic panels may experience a considerable decrease in energy result. Nevertheless, it's worth keeping in mind that some contemporary solar panel innovations can still produce electrical power even when the sky is over cast. In addition, rain can have a cleaning result on photovoltaic panels, removing dirt and dust that may have built up over time.
